US Surgeon General Issues Rare Advisory for E-Cigarette Use
Description
The US Surgeon General issued an advisory, urging “aggressive steps” be taken to prevent e-cigarette brands from getting millions of teenagers addicted to their products. Veuer's Sam Berman has the full story.
